What is the point called where the perpendicular bisectors of the sides of a triangle intersect
Vikki [24]
Answer: Circumcenter

This is the center of the circle that goes through the three vertices of the triangle. This circle is known as the circumcircle. It is the smallest circle possible in which the circle encompasses the triangle and none of the triangle spills outside the circle.
